About this clipart
This precise line drawing depicts the left lateral view of an adult horse skull, highlighting key skeletal elements such as the premaxilla (PMX), maxilla (MX), nasal (NA), frontal (FR), parietal (P), occipital (O), and condylar (CO) regions. Each bone is marked with its standard anatomical abbreviation, facilitating identification for students and professionals in veterinary medicine or comparative anatomy. The illustration emphasizes dental structure, orbital cavity, and cranial sutures.
